> Why can't we just have the quirk detect the interrupts-extended
> property, which is not present on boards without the workaround.
> Wouldn't that be better? No dts change needed.
>
I pondered that idea too, but have gone with the solution presented in
this patch series as it's more explicit and - with far more weight to it
- does not require the driver to touch DT properties that are outside of
its domain of responsibility. The "interrupts-extended" properties are
not meant to be parsed by the driver, but rather the IRQ subsystem.
